Question
Factor the expression
(x−8)(x+4)
Evaluate
x2−4x−32
Rewrite the expression
x2+(4−8)x−32
Calculate
x2+4x−8x−32
Rewrite the expression
x×x+x×4−8x−8×4
Factor out x from the expression
x(x+4)−8x−8×4
Factor out −8 from the expression
x(x+4)−8(x+4)
Solution
(x−8)(x+4)
